Weather in Dueodde in March

Temperatures on an average day in Dueodde in March

The average temperature in Dueodde in March for a typical day ranges from a high of 39°F (4°C) to a low of 36°F (2°C). Some would describe the temperature to be really cold. The general area may also feel slightly windy.

For comparison, the hottest month in Dueodde, August, has days with highs of 67°F (19°C) and lows of 64°F (18°C). The coldest month, February has days with highs of 37°F (3°C) and lows of 34°F (1°C). This graph shows how an average day looks like in Dueodde in March based on historical data.

Known for its ultra-fine sand, this beach with a lighthouse on its southern tip stretches for miles.

Very fine sand (the Danish Queen used to get sand from Dueodde beach to dry the ink of her letters), huge dunes, a pretty light house, a beautiful duen forest, and probably the best softice on the island make Dueodde a prime place to visit. Forget about the restaurants there and enjoy the nature. The pink Kiosk is worthy a visit though.
